WARNING! THE SEESAW IS ONLY SUITABLE FOR BALANCE BIKES and SOME very small pedal bikes – PLEASE CHECK
BEFORE USE! The rear wheel must be on the ramp surface before the SEESAW tips. Longer wheelbase bikes may
cause the seesaw to tip BEFORE the rear wheel is on the ramp causing the bike to stop dead! It is NOT designed for
launching other children into the AIR that are not on bikes 
Thank you for buying our Skill Station. You now have an incredibly versatile coaching and training aid to develop young rider's
skills. It has been designed with beginners in mind to focus on Core Bike Handling Skills in a fun and challenging way. You will get
maximum flexibility and progression by pairing the Skill Station with 1 or 2 Rookie Progression Ramps. However, it will work
perfectly with fixed height ramps such as the Classic 200 / 350 and Core 200 and 350 straight or Curved Ramps but you will not
have the benefits of intermediate height adjustment provided by the Rookie Ramps.
Our goal was to give users the ability to build confidence with ease by gaining height in small increments.
We have applied a lower load rating of 75 kgs on this equipment because it is designed for young children. In some settings such
as the 1200 tabletop you will notice some flex and this is normal! The equipment is very strong, but will have a LOT of flex in
certain settings if used by older children or adults and may fail if overloaded. We recommend our Progression Tabletop's if you
need a set up that is designed for heavier and older riders that has been designed for heavy use and high loads.
** You can use your Station on its own as a Standalone 200 mm HIGH Jump or Landing Ramp!
